31.8mm UHC Filter Optolong

UHC (Ultra High Contrast) Filter is among the most popular filter types for reducing light pollution.

UHC filter is usually used for visual observation, it features the classic Gaussian cut which allows to redue light pollution coming from sodium lamps.

UHC.png

Utilization and Performance

Suitable for viewing low emission nebulae in H-beta 486nm, OIII 496nm, OIII 500nm, H-alpha 656nm, and SII 672nm with a transmission of 95% even in moon light or heavy light pollution conditions.

The UHC filter does not eliminate the effects of light pollution and does not increase the brightness of the object being shot, but instead increases the contrast between the nebula and the night sky, making image processing easier.

This UHC filter is designed to be attached to eyepieces, to filter wheels,  to filter drawers or directly on CLIP model cameras.

Techincal Specifications

Technical Data

  • Schott substrate material
  • Thickness 2.0 mm (1.25”/2”)
  • Thickness 1.0 mm (Clip series)

 

Spectral Curve

  • The Major Emission Lines of Nebulae
  • H-b is 486.1 nm
  • OIII is 495.9 nm and 500.7 nm
  • SII is 672 nm
  • H-a is 656.3 nm

 

  • The Major Emission Lines of Artificial Light Pollution
  • Hg is 435.8 nm, 546.1 nm, 577 nm, and 578.1 nm
  • Na is 598 nm, 589.6 nm, 615.4 nm, and 616.1 nm

Coating Parameter

  • Non-cementing optical substrate coating
  • Electron-beam gun evaporation with low Ion-assisted deposition coating technology for durability and resistance to scratching, as well  as stability on CWL (central wavelength) no deviation affected by temperature change
  • Planetary rotation system offers precision and homogeneity of coatings ensuring high value on tansmission of pass-band and Optical density of off-band
